5th Wheel Hitch Installation on a 2002 Chevrolet Duramax Short Box
Question:
Ihave a Reese 15000 lbs regular fifth wheel with horizontal rails I would like to mount into the above truck I would like to know where to mount this in my short box. The space from the back rail to tailgate also the position of the king pin over the axle thank you for your time
asked by: James Y
Expert Reply:
I am going to assume that you have a Universal Base Rail Installation Kit, item # RP30035, with your 15,000 lb fifth-wheel hitch. I have posted a link to the instructions for this install kit. The back edge of the rear base rail for the short bed should be 25-1/8 inches from the rear edge of the truck bed. The fifth-wheel king pin will centered over the rear axle when installed in the correct position for your vehicle.
